Ceramic Tile

ceramic roof

Ceramic tiles are the most popular and can be found in different types and colors. They are a great alternative for those who want different options when planning the roof of their dreams. They provide great thermal comfort, making internal environments more pleasant.

Despite these great features, ceramic tiles are fragile, as misuse can damage them and impair your roof. In addition, their weight can be a negative differential for those planning a quality roof with a simpler structure.

The high porosity of this material causes ceramic tiles to absorb rainwater in order to eliminate it under more suitable conditions. This increases its weight and can damage the woodwork of your roof, causing problems such as leaks, infiltrations, and the passage of air through the rooms.

Fiber-cement roof tiles

Fiber-cement tiles are a very economical solution for those who have a limited budget when renovating or building a quality roof. This material is easy to install, durable and impermeable, making it the perfect cost-effective alternative.

However, these tiles have some considerable disadvantages that can be the divisor of opinions when considering this option as a good alternative for your project. A negative point of this material is the fact that it overheats the inside of the building, making it uncomfortable during periods of intense heat.

In addition, its use may end up devaluing the aesthetics of your property, since fiber cement has a very simplistic design. This can be a very negative characteristic for those who want a more elegant and sophisticated project.

Ecological Tile

ecological roof tiles riverside

One of the trends that has been conquering the market because of its cost-effectiveness are the ecological tiles. They present a series of advantages, mainly when compared to the other models found in the market. 

We start with the main one, their composition. It is made of recycled materials, being a great sustainable alternative for your project. This characteristic does not leave it behind in any point, being a great option for those who want a beautiful and different quality roof on their property.

Because it is lighter than other tiles on the market, it weighs up to 3.4 kg per m². This means that a ceramic tile can be up to 12 times heavier than the ecological model.

With this, we can affirm that the installation process is much more economical in the final budget of your work. Its low weight allows for greater practicality during transportation and installation, often requiring only one or two people to apply it on your roof. In addition, it is very resistant to falls, ensuring great durability and a longer useful life.

Another highlight is that it is able to successfully drain water away from your roof structure, avoiding overloading. That said, all these features are essential to reduce expenses with the installation and maintenance of your quality roof, making it possible to get more out of your investment.

In addition, despite being very light, they are very resistant to winds of more than 250 km/h, ensuring greater protection to the property. Last but not least, we highlight that this model is capable of staying up to 2º C colder than the other types, besides cooling down faster during the night.

Transparent tile

For those who want to have a more sustainable lifestyle, transparent tiles are a great option to add value to your property and still bring comfort and better quality of life. Its main feature is that it allows the passage of sunlight in internal environments, ensuring lit spaces for longer throughout the day.

This avoids unnecessary spending on artificial lighting. In addition, natural light allows less strain on the eyesight, providing benefits directly to your health.

The advantages of transparent tiles do not stop there. It has great color options for different tastes, making it a very versatile product for your project. It offers great resistance and is practically unbreakable – it can withstand impacts 50 times greater than acrylic models, for example.

Its high flexibility is a great feature, allowing a much simpler and more practical installation. In addition, transparent tiles have a protection against UV radiation, supporting temperature variations from -50º C to 135º C.
